Your opportunity

  • As part of the Financial Risk team, deliver an effective risk oversight programme including market risk, liquidity risk, counterparty credit risk, and ESG oversight

  • Produce regular and ad hoc risk reporting and analysis to support the Financial Risk governance committees and fund boards

  • Monitor of risk limits and thresholds, and perform risk assessments

  • Identify and develop new, and enhance existing Financial Risk processes

  • Partner with stakeholders to support, maintain, and enhance the risk management tools used by the Financial Risk team

  • Partner with IT to develop and implement enhancements and new functionality to systems that enable the assessment, monitoring, and reporting of risk

  • Build and maintain strong relationships between the Financial Risk team and other teams within Janus Henderson

  • Carry out other duties as assigned

    Must have skills

  • Excellent analytical skills, with a strong understanding of risk measures and methodologies and regulatory practice in risk management, covering market, liquidity, counterparty and ESG risks

  • Knowledge and understanding of risk models such as MSCI RiskMetrics

  • Ability to work with large data sets, producing metrics and other analytics for reporting and analysis, and the ability to present results

  • Ability to communicate complex concepts and methodologies to a wide range of stakeholders, both written and verbal

  • Strong organisational skills and attention to detail

  • Proactive and self-sufficient attitude, and team-oriented

  • Excellent MS Office skills

    Nice to have skills

  • Professional qualifications

  • Coding languages such as python and SQL

  • Strong knowledge and experience with risk management practices across different asset classes, and investment strategies gained from previous investment management industry experience
